WebMay 19, 2024 · Primarily, St. Anne is the patron saint of mothers, stemming from her status as the mother of Mary, who was the mother of Christ. The conditions of her pregnancy also made her the patron saint of women in labor or those who desire to become pregnant; other related patronages include being the patron saint of unmarried women and housewives. WebSaint Nicholas is the patron saint of sailors, merchants, archers, repentant thieves, children, brewers, pawnbrokers, unmarried people, and students in various cities and countries around Europe.
